MBBS Admission in Kolkata
Kolkata is a major medical education hub in West Bengal with 2,600+ MBBS seats across government and private colleges. Students from Kolkata and nearby districts compete through NEET and WBMCC West Bengal counselling. We help local families with college shortlisting, fee transparency, and round-wise choice filling.

Frequently asked questions
Which are the best MBBS colleges in Kolkata?
Leading options include Medical College Kolkata, RG Kar Medical College, Calcutta National Medical College, IPGMER SSKM Hospital. The best fit depends on your NEET rank, budget, and whether you target government or private seats. We provide a rank-wise shortlist — not generic lists.
What NEET score do I need for MBBS in Kolkata?
Indicative range for general category is 420–580, but cutoffs change every year by college and quota. Share your exact rank for a personalised assessment.
Does Kolkata have domicile quota advantages in West Bengal?
West Bengal state counselling typically reserves the majority of seats for state domicile candidates. Eligibility rules vary — we verify your category and documentation before counselling starts.
